Built with purpose
Helical piles transfer structural loads through weaker surface soils into stable bearing layers. Their compact installation equipment and immediate capacity make them useful across an unusually broad range of projects.
Final suitability depends on loads, soil, access, and design requirements; our team can help determine whether piles make sense for your project.

Residential to municipal
Helical piles are especially useful when a project needs permanent structural support with limited excavation, immediate load capacity, or access through an established property. They can be installed below frost depth and designed for compression, tension, and lateral loads.
Across Halton Region and Southern Ontario, common applications include decks, additions, sunrooms, cottages, sheds, garages, underpinning, boardwalks, signage, solar infrastructure, equipment platforms, and light commercial buildings. Suitability depends on the structural design, soil, load requirements, and installation access.
